The BSC PREFERRED MAT163BR is a heavy-duty entrance floor mat designed to remove dirt, water, and debris from footwear before it tracks into a facility. The raised square waffle pattern mechanically scrapes soles clean on contact, while the mat body absorbs water, snow melt, and ice melt to keep adjacent flooring surfaces drier. The mat dries quickly after saturation and is engineered to resist color fading under regular use and UV exposure. Cleaning is straightforward: vacuum, hose off, steam clean, or shampoo as needed. This product is an equivalent replacement for part number H-629BR. Facility maintenance professionals and safety coordinators are the typical end users.
The MAT163BR is suited for commercial and institutional entryways, vestibules, and transition zones where foot traffic brings in moisture and debris. Typical applications include building lobbies, warehouse entry points, break rooms, and any high-traffic threshold area where slip hazard reduction and floor cleanliness are priorities. The waffle surface design makes it effective in both wet and dry seasonal conditions, performing in rain, snow, and everyday dirt accumulation without matting down or losing scraping effectiveness.

Entrance mats should be positioned flat at entry thresholds with all edges lying flush to the floor surface to eliminate trip hazards in compliance with applicable facility safety standards. Verify the installation surface is clean and dry before placing the mat to promote even contact and prevent curling. No mechanical fasteners are typically required for standard entryway applications, but verify local safety codes for permanent or high-traffic commercial installations. Inspect mat edges periodically for lifting or curl that could create a slip or trip risk.
